最新接入DeepSeek-V3模型,点击下载最新版本InsCode AI IDE
蓝桥杯竞赛:编程小白如何借助智能工具实现逆袭
引言
蓝桥杯全国软件和信息技术专业人才大赛(简称“蓝桥杯”)作为国内知名的IT类赛事,吸引了众多高校学生和编程爱好者参与。每年的比赛不仅是对选手技术实力的考验,更是对其解决问题能力、创新思维和团队协作能力的全面挑战。对于许多初学者来说,蓝桥杯既是机遇也是挑战。本文将探讨如何利用智能化工具——如新一代AI编程助手,帮助参赛者在比赛中脱颖而出。
智能化工具助力编程学习与实践
随着人工智能技术的发展,越来越多的智能工具被引入到编程领域。这些工具不仅能够提高开发效率,还能帮助初学者快速掌握编程技能。以优快云与华为联合发布的InsCode AI IDE为例,这款集成开发环境(IDE)为开发者提供了高效、便捷且智能化的编程体验。它通过内置的AI对话框,使得编程初学者也能通过简单的自然语言交流来快速实现代码补全、修改项目代码、生成注释等功能。
InsCode AI IDE的应用场景
-
代码生成与优化 在蓝桥杯比赛中,时间就是生命。使用InsCode AI IDE,参赛者可以通过自然语言描述需求,快速生成符合要求的代码片段。例如,在解决数据结构或算法问题时,只需输入问题描述,AI便会自动生成相应的代码框架,极大地节省了编写基础代码的时间。此外,InsCode AI IDE还具备全局改写功能,可以理解整个项目并生成/修改多个文件,确保代码的一致性和完整性。
-
调试与错误修复 编程过程中难免会遇到各种错误和异常情况。InsCode AI IDE内置了强大的调试工具,支持交互式调试器,允许用户逐步查看源代码、检查变量、查看调用堆栈,并在控制台中执行命令。如果遇到难以解决的问题,还可以将错误信息告诉AI,让其进行查错修正,从而快速定位并解决问题。
-
单元测试与性能优化 为了保证代码的质量和可靠性,编写单元测试是必不可少的步骤。InsCode AI IDE可以为您的代码生成单元测试用例,帮助您快速验证代码的准确性,提高代码的测试覆盖率和质量。同时,它还能够分析代码性能,给出性能瓶颈并执行优化方案,确保程序在高负载下依然保持高效运行。
-
学习与成长 对于编程小白而言,理解和掌握复杂的编程概念可能是一项艰巨的任务。InsCode AI IDE具备快速解释代码的能力,能够帮助开发者快速理解代码逻辑,提高开发效率。此外,它还支持添加注释,提升代码可读性;提供智能问答服务,应对编程领域的多种挑战,如代码解析、语法指导、优化建议等。
实战案例分享
在今年的蓝桥杯比赛中,来自湖南大学(HNU)的小李同学便借助InsCode AI IDE取得了优异的成绩。他回忆道:“以前参加比赛时,总是担心自己写的代码不够好,尤其是在面对一些复杂的算法题时,往往需要花费大量时间去思考解决方案。自从使用了InsCode AI IDE后,一切都变得简单多了。通过自然语言描述需求,AI迅速生成了完整的代码框架,让我有更多时间和精力专注于优化细节。”
另一位参赛者小张也表示:“InsCode AI IDE不仅提高了我的编程效率,更重要的是培养了我的编程思维。它教会我如何更高效地解决问题,这对我未来的职业发展有着深远的影响。”
结语
蓝桥杯竞赛不仅是检验个人技术水平的舞台,更是提升自我、积累经验的良好机会。借助像InsCode AI IDE这样的智能化工具,编程小白们也可以在比赛中找到自信,实现逆袭。无论是从零开始的学习者,还是已经具备一定基础的开发者,都可以通过InsCode AI IDE获得前所未有的编程体验。现在就下载InsCode AI IDE,开启属于你的编程之旅吧!
下载链接
即刻下载体验 最新版本InsCode AI IDE创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考